What Makes Allure Resilient Plank Flooring Special

Allure resilient plank flooring stands apart from traditional options due to its multi-layer construction that delivers genuine wood aesthetics with modern performance. The top layer features a protective wear coating that resists scratches, dents, and fading from sunlight exposure. Beneath this sits a printed design layer that replicates authentic wood grain patterns with remarkable accuracy.

The core layer provides structural stability while the backing offers sound dampening properties that reduce footfall noise. This construction makes it ideal for busy households with children and pets who need flooring that can withstand daily activity without showing wear.

Unlike traditional hardwood, resilient plank flooring requires no sanding or refinishing over its lifespan. The click-lock installation system allows homeowners to install the planks themselves without professional help, saving significant labor costs. Most products in this category also carry warranties ranging from ten to twenty-five years, giving homeowners confidence in their investment.

Installation Process and Preparation

Installing Allure resilient plank flooring begins with proper room preparation. The subfloor must be clean, dry, and level within specific tolerances to ensure the planks lay flat without gaps or uneven surfaces. Most installations work over concrete, plywood, or existing hard surface floors, though some manufacturers recommend moisture barriers for below-grade applications.

The click-lock mechanism allows planks to interlock without adhesive, creating a floating floor that moves slightly with temperature and humidity changes. This flexibility reduces the risk of buckling or separation over time. Homeowners typically complete an average-sized room installation within a single day using basic tools like a utility knife, measuring tape, and tapping block.

Proper acclimation is essential before installation. Planks should rest in the room where they will be installed for at least forty-eight hours to adjust to local temperature and humidity conditions. This step prevents expansion or contraction issues after the floor is secured.

Maintenance and Longevity

Maintaining Allure resilient plank flooring requires minimal effort compared to other flooring types. Regular sweeping or vacuuming removes loose dirt and debris that could scratch the surface over time. Occasional damp mopping with a manufacturer-approved cleaner keeps the floor looking fresh and bright.

Avoid using excessive water during cleaning, as standing moisture can seep into seams and cause damage. Most resilient planks resist stains from common household substances including coffee, wine, and pet accidents when cleaned promptly.

With proper care, these floors maintain their appearance for decades without requiring refinishing or replacement. The protective wear layer prevents the design layer from fading or wearing through, even in high-traffic areas like entryways and hallways.

Comparing Allure to Other Flooring Options

Allure resilient plank flooring competes directly with luxury vinyl tile, laminate, and engineered hardwood products. Unlike traditional laminate, it offers superior water resistance without special sealing requirements. Compared to luxury vinyl tile, planks provide a more authentic wood appearance with less visual repetition.

Engineered hardwood delivers similar aesthetics but requires more maintenance and costs significantly more per square foot. Allure resilient plank flooring provides comparable visual appeal at a fraction of the price while offering better moisture resistance than most engineered options.

For homeowners weighing multiple choices, the combination of affordability, durability, and ease of installation makes resilient plank flooring an attractive choice for both renovation projects and new construction.

Practical Tips for Homeowners

Consider underlayment when installing over concrete subfloors to improve comfort and sound reduction. Use felt pads on furniture legs to prevent scratching during movement. Rotate area rugs periodically to ensure even wear across high-traffic zones.

When replacing the floor, keep extra planks from the original installation for future repairs or touch-ups. Store them in a dry location where they will not be exposed to extreme temperatures or humidity changes.

Frequently Asked Questions

How long does Allure resilient plank flooring last?

With proper care and normal household use, these floors typically last fifteen to twenty-five years. The exact lifespan depends on traffic levels, installation quality, and maintenance practices. High-traffic areas may show wear sooner but can often be repaired sectionally.

Can I install Allure flooring over existing tile or vinyl?

Yes, most manufacturers approve installation over existing hard surface floors including ceramic tile, vinyl sheet, and laminate. The subfloor must be level and clean for proper installation results. Remove any loose tiles or damaged areas before beginning.

Is Allure resilient plank flooring waterproof?

Most products offer excellent water resistance that handles spills and occasional moisture exposure without damage. While not fully waterproof in the sense of being submerged, they perform well in kitchens, bathrooms, and laundry rooms where water contact occurs regularly.

How do I clean Allure resilient plank flooring?

Sweep or vacuum regularly to remove abrasive dirt particles. Use a damp mop with mild cleaner when needed. Avoid steam mops unless specifically approved by the manufacturer, as excessive heat and moisture can affect the planks over time.

Does this flooring feel cold underfoot?

Resilient plank flooring feels warmer than ceramic tile or stone because of its material composition. It also provides some cushioning underfoot that reduces fatigue during extended standing periods compared to harder surfaces.
